    Understanding Legal Frameworks in Real Estate Transactions

    When engaging in real estate transactions, a comprehensive understanding of the legal frameworks is crucial. These frameworks not only facilitate smooth dealings but also protect the rights and interests of all parties involved. Key components of these legal frameworks include contracts, property laws, and zoning regulations. A solid contract lays the groundwork for the transaction and should clearly outline the terms, conditions, and responsibilities of each party. Property laws determine ownership rights, while zoning regulations dictate permissible uses for land, which can substantially affect the value and potential of a property.

    Several essential legal steps are vital to navigate this complex landscape effectively. These steps include:

    • Conducting Title Searches: Ensuring that the title is clear of liens or encumbrances.
    • Reviewing Disclosures: Understanding any potential issues with the property that the seller must disclose.
    • Involving Legal Experts: Engaging real estate attorneys to address intricate legal terminologies and requirements.
    • Securing Financing: Navigating legal requirements for mortgages and loans.

    Moreover, awareness of the various legal entities involved—such as real estate agents, inspectors, and appraisers—is essential for a well-rounded approach. Each plays a distinct role in ensuring compliance and upholding legal standards throughout the process. Below is a concise table to summarize their primary responsibilities:

    Entity Primary Responsibility
    Real Estate Agent Facilitates transaction and negotiates terms.
    Property Inspector Evaluates condition of the property.
    Appraiser Determines property value for financing.

    Conducting due diligence to Mitigate Risks

    Performing thorough due diligence is critical in uncovering potential risks associated with a real estate investment. This process involves extensive research and analysis of various aspects of the property, including ownership history, financial records, and local market conditions. Stakeholders should focus on key areas such as:

    • Property Title: Verify that the title is clear and free of liens or encumbrances.
    • Zoning regulations: Ensure that the property complies with local zoning laws and use regulations.
    • Environmental Issues: Investigate any past environmental concerns that may affect the property’s value or usability.
    • Financial Assessments: Review income statements, tax records, and expense reports related to the investment.

    Additionally,engaging with professionals like real estate attorneys and agents can provide invaluable insights and legal protections. A comprehensive risk assessment should include an examination of the following factors:

    risk Factor Mitigation Strategy
    Market Volatility Diverse investment portfolio.
    repair and Maintenance Costs Conduct property inspections before purchase.
    Legal Disputes Employ a qualified real estate attorney.

    Establishing Contracts and Agreements for Secure investments

    When venturing into real estate investments, crafting a robust framework of contracts and agreements is pivotal for safeguarding your assets. These documents not only define the terms of the investment but also delineate the responsibilities of all parties involved. Key elements to include in your agreements are:

    • Clear Identification: Details of all parties involved, including their roles and obligations.
    • Financial Terms: Specification of investment amounts, payment schedules, and any interest rates applicable.
    • Contingencies: Conditions under which the agreement can be terminated or renegotiated.
    • Dispute Resolution: procedures to resolve any conflicts that may arise, including mediation or arbitration clauses.

    Moreover, employing professionally drafted contracts helps mitigate risks associated with misunderstandings and legal disputes. Utilize a standardized format that fosters openness and trust among all parties. Below is a simple comparison of potential contract types:

    Contract Type Purpose Key Features
    Purchase Agreement To outline the sale of a property price, conditions the buyer must meet, and an earnest money deposit.
    Lease Agreement To establish the terms of renting a property Duration, rent amount, and tenant responsibilities.
    Joint Venture Agreement For partnerships in investment Equity shares, decision-making powers, and profit distribution.

    Navigating Property Laws and Regulations for Protection

    Understanding property laws and regulations is crucial for safeguarding your real estate investments. These laws vary significantly based on location, making it imperative to have a comprehensive grasp of both federal and state requirements. Familiarizing yourself with terms such as zoning laws, land use regulations, and property rights will empower you to navigate the complexities of real estate ownership. It’s advisable to consult legal experts to ensure compliance with all local regulations and to understand the implications of properties in various zones, including residential, commercial, and industrial areas.

    Moreover, regular updates on regulatory changes can prevent unexpected complications. Here are some essential legal steps to consider:

    • Research Local Ordinances: Stay informed about any changes that might affect your property.
    • Obtain Necessary Permits: Ensure all renovations or constructions comply with local codes.
    • Understand Tenant Rights: Familiarize yourself with laws governing tenant relationships to avoid legal disputes.
    • review Contracts Carefully: Whether buying or leasing, a thorough examination of contracts protects your investment.
    Action Importance
    Consult with a Property Attorney Helps avoid costly legal issues
    Regular Property Inspection Identifies potential legal liabilities early
    Engage a Real Estate Agent Provides insight into local market and laws
    Stay Updated on Tax Regulations Ensures compliance and optimizes tax benefits
